Total Exercise Volume Matters Most
A large study published by the American Heart Association confirms that total weekly exercise volume predicts health benefits better than workout frequency. Weekend warriors and daily exercisers achieved similar improvements in heart and metabolic health.
A 2024 Nature Aging trial reinforced this finding: consistent exercise volume reduced risks of stroke, Parkinson’s, and dementia.
Why Isokinetic Machines Stand Out
- Adaptive Resistance: Machines automatically match your effort.
- Consistent Engagement: Muscles work evenly through each movement.
- Immediate Feedback: Sensors track output, form, and progress for safe, effective workouts.
Twice-Weekly Workouts Deliver Strength Gains
- Muscle Development: Two high-intensity sessions can drive growth, especially when paired with proper recovery.
- Accessible for Older Adults: Even once-weekly sessions maintain and improve strength, making it easy to start or continue training.
